New Rules: There are a number of new rules from the US EPA that may affect many small businesses in Wisconsin. The Small Business Clean Air Assistance Program is monitoring these rules for potential impact. When appropriate the program will develop fact sheets summarizing the rule, send out letters indicating where to submit notification forms, and post all relevant materials on their Air Toxics web page. Currently there are materials available for rules affecting autobody refinishing shops, anyone painting plastic or metal parts, and gasoline distribution/bulk plants.
